Common Foundation Lifting Jobs
Foundation stabilization - improves structural integrity of homes with shifting or settling foundations.
Pier and beam lifting - raises and levels homes built on pier and beam foundations.
Concrete slab lifting - restores levelness to sunken or uneven concrete slabs.
Basement support - reinforces basement walls to prevent bowing or cracking.
Crawl space leveling - corrects uneven crawl space floors to prevent further settlement.
Structural repairs - addresses foundation issues that impact the safety and stability of a property.
Foundation Lifting Questions
What is foundation lifting? Foundation lifting is a process that raises and stabilizes a settled or sinking foundation to restore proper levelness and support.
When is foundation lifting needed? It is typically needed when signs like cracks, uneven floors, or sticking doors appear due to foundation settlement.
What methods are used for foundation lifting? Common methods include underpinning with piers or piles to lift and stabilize the foundation.
Will foundation lifting prevent future issues? Properly performed foundation lifting can help mitigate further settling and structural problems over time.
